Johann Sebastian Bach's Prelude and Fugue No. 18 in G sharp minor is part of his second book of The Well-Tempered Clavier, which was completed in 1744. The piece is written for keyboard and is one of the most challenging pieces in the collection. The Prelude is marked as Adagio and is in a slow tempo. It begins with a descending arpeggio in the right hand, which is then followed by a series of chords. The left hand plays a simple bass line, which provides a foundation for the piece. The Prelude is characterized by its melancholic and introspective mood, which is emphasized by the use of chromaticism and dissonance. The Fugue is marked as Allegro and is in a fast tempo. It is written in three voices and is based on a subject that is introduced in the first measure. The subject is a descending chromatic line that is then followed by a series of ascending intervals. The Fugue is characterized by its contrapuntal complexity, which is typical of Bach's music. The three voices are interwoven in a complex and intricate manner, creating a rich and dense texture. The piece is notable for its use of enharmonic modulation, which is a technique that involves changing the key of a piece by using the same notes with different names. This technique is used in both the Prelude and the Fugue, creating a sense of harmonic ambiguity and tension. The Prelude and Fugue No. 18 in G sharp minor was premiered by Bach himself and has since become a staple of the keyboard repertoire. It is a challenging piece that requires technical proficiency and musical sensitivity. Its melancholic and introspective mood, combined with its contrapuntal complexity, make it a masterpiece of Baroque music.
